gpt4 book ai didi

java - 错位的构造

转载 作者:行者123 更新时间:2023-12-02 03:51:57 25 4
gpt4 key购买 nike

我收到几个“构造错误”错误和“删除 token ”错误。 Oracle 网站上对这些错误的描述相当模糊。我不知道问题出在哪里,但似乎我有一个括号不合适,导致整个程序失败。有人能看出我做错了什么吗?

public class divisorCalc2 {
import java.util.Scanner; //Imports scanner class

public static int gcd(int num1, int num2) {
if (num2 == 0) {
return num1;
} else {
return gcd(num2, num1 % num2);
}
}

public static void main(String[] args) {
System.out.println("Please enter first integer:");
int firstInt = in.nextInt();

System.out.println("Please enter second integer:");
int secondInt = in.nextInt();

System.out.println(gcd(firstInt,secondInt));

in.close(); //Closes Scanner
}
}

最佳答案

一个方法不能包含在另一个方法中。将整个 gcd 代码放在 main 之外。

main (...){
...
}

gcd (...){
...
}

关于java - 错位的构造,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35802306/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com